5. Legal Implications
The utilization of video downloader applications on Apple’s iOS platform is inherently intertwined with various legal considerations. The act of downloading copyrighted video content without proper authorization can result in significant legal repercussions for the end-user.
-
Copyright Infringement
Downloading copyrighted videos without permission from the copyright holder constitutes copyright infringement, a violation of intellectual property law. This encompasses movies, television shows, music videos, and other forms of video content protected by copyright. Legal consequences can include fines, civil lawsuits, and, in some cases, criminal prosecution. For example, downloading a commercially released film from an unauthorized source is a direct violation of copyright law.
-
Terms of Service Violations
Many online video platforms, such as YouTube and Vimeo, have terms of service that explicitly prohibit the downloading of video content. Circumventing these restrictions through the use of “video downloader ios” applications constitutes a breach of contract. While the legal consequences may not be as severe as copyright infringement, platforms may suspend or terminate user accounts for violating their terms of service. An example includes using an application to download videos from YouTube despite YouTube’s explicit prohibition against such activity.
-
Distribution of Illegally Obtained Content
The act of not only downloading but also distributing copyrighted videos obtained through a “video downloader ios” significantly increases the potential for legal liability. Sharing downloaded content with others, whether for profit or not, may be considered a more serious offense than simply downloading for personal use. For instance, uploading a downloaded film to a file-sharing website constitutes copyright infringement and unauthorized distribution.
-
Geo-Restrictions and Regional Copyright Laws
Downloading video content that is only legally available in specific geographic regions may violate regional copyright laws. Content providers often implement geo-restrictions to comply with licensing agreements. Bypassing these restrictions with a “video downloader ios” to access content not legally available in a user’s location could be considered a violation of copyright law. An example includes downloading a television show that is exclusively licensed to a streaming service in another country.
The legal ramifications associated with utilizing a “video downloader ios” are multi-faceted and dependent on various factors, including the source of the video, the terms of service of the video platform, and the applicable copyright laws. Users must exercise caution and ensure they have the necessary rights or permissions before downloading and distributing any video content. Engaging in unauthorized downloading can expose individuals to legal risks and financial penalties. Prior consideration of potential copyright infringement is crucial.
6. Storage Capacity
Storage capacity represents a fundamental limitation on the utility of any application designed for downloading video content onto iOS devices. The available storage space on an iPhone or iPad directly dictates the quantity and quality of videos that can be saved. Insufficient storage inhibits the user’s ability to accumulate a substantial offline library or to download videos at higher resolutions.
-
Resolution and File Size
A direct correlation exists between the resolution of a video and its file size. Higher resolution videos, such as those in 4K or 1080p, demand significantly more storage space than standard definition (SD) videos. For instance, a full-length movie in 4K resolution might consume several gigabytes, while the same movie in SD resolution could be under a gigabyte. Users with limited storage must balance their desire for high-quality viewing with the available space on their device.
-
Codec Efficiency
The video codec used for encoding affects file size without necessarily impacting perceived quality. Modern codecs like H.265 (HEVC) are more efficient than older codecs like H.264 (AVC), allowing for smaller file sizes at comparable video quality. A “video downloader ios” application’s ability to support and utilize efficient codecs is crucial for maximizing storage capacity. A video encoded with HEVC might occupy significantly less space than the same video encoded with AVC.
-
Download Management Strategies
Effective storage management strategies within the application are essential. Features like the ability to select download resolution, pause and resume downloads, and delete unwanted files are crucial for optimizing storage utilization. An application lacking these features may quickly fill up storage, hindering further downloads. A user should be able to remove viewed or unneeded content.
-
External Storage Options
While iOS devices traditionally lack expandable storage, certain workarounds exist, such as using external storage drives or cloud storage services. A “video downloader ios” application’s compatibility with these external storage options can significantly extend a user’s storage capacity. The user downloads into the application and then transfers to a different storage medium.
In summary, storage capacity is a primary factor governing the usefulness of a “video downloader ios”. The interplay between video resolution, codec efficiency, download management strategies, and external storage options dictates how effectively users can leverage such applications to build and maintain offline video libraries. Limited available storage will significantly impact download choices.
7. Security Risks
The employment of applications designed for downloading video content onto Apple’s iOS platform introduces distinct security risks that necessitate careful consideration. These risks stem from the potential exposure of devices to malicious software, unauthorized access to personal data, and violations of user privacy. Comprehensive awareness and proactive mitigation strategies are essential for safe and responsible utilization of these applications.
-
Malware Infection
A primary security risk involves the potential for malware infection. Unofficial or modified applications, often distributed through third-party app stores or websites, may contain malicious code designed to compromise device security. This code can execute covertly, leading to data theft, system instability, or unauthorized access to sensitive information. Downloading applications from sources other than the official Apple App Store significantly increases this risk. An example would be the surreptitious installation of spyware bundled with a video downloader, allowing remote monitoring of user activity.
-
Data Breaches
Certain applications request excessive permissions, granting them access to personal data beyond what is necessary for their core functionality. This data can include contacts, location information, browsing history, and other sensitive details. Inadequate security measures or malicious intent can lead to data breaches, exposing user information to unauthorized parties. A video downloader requesting access to a user’s contacts list raises concerns about potential data harvesting and privacy violations.
-
Phishing Attacks
Video downloader applications can serve as vectors for phishing attacks. These attacks involve tricking users into revealing sensitive information, such as passwords or financial details, through deceptive interfaces or messages. A fraudulent application might mimic the login screen of a legitimate video platform, capturing user credentials entered by unsuspecting users. This can lead to account compromise and potential financial loss.
-
Unintended App Behavior
Even legitimate applications can exhibit unintended behavior that compromises security or privacy. Bugs, vulnerabilities, or poorly designed features can create openings for malicious actors to exploit. An example is an application with a memory leak that gradually consumes system resources, leading to device instability or exposing sensitive data stored in memory. Regular software updates and careful review of application permissions are essential for mitigating these risks.
The potential security risks associated with “video downloader ios” applications underscore the importance of exercising caution when selecting and utilizing such tools. Downloading applications only from trusted sources, carefully reviewing requested permissions, and implementing proactive security measures are crucial steps in mitigating these risks. Failure to address these security concerns can lead to significant negative consequences, including data loss, privacy violations, and device compromise.
